Supplement Highlights

images A model is a purposeful representation of the key factors in a situation and of the relationships among them. It abstracts the real situation, incorporating those factors that are important to the decision it was designed to address.

images The main types of models are mental models, visual models, physical models, and mathematical models. Spreadsheet models are essentially mathematical models and are the focus of this supplement.

images Mathematical models translate inputs into outputs through a set of relationships. Inputs consist of uncontrollable inputs and controllable inputs, sometimes called decision variables. There can be many outputs of mathematical models, but often we are interested in a relatively small number of primary outputs.

images The recommended spreadsheet modeling process consists of understanding the problem, drawing a sketch of the model, developing a base-case spreadsheet, testing the spreadsheet, using the model to perform analysis, and documenting the model.
